Resumen de Non-plane reflecting surfaces in room acoustics

Mezhlum A. Sumbatyan, Nikolay V. Boyev

  • Very often the spaces considered in the ambit of room acoustics possess non-pane reflecting surfaces (Baroque-style constructions, Orthodox churches, etc). The nowadays approaches to simulate such reflecting surfaces operate with them like with a set of plane patches globally forming the real crooked surface. This technique implies that the wave interaction with the crooked surface is locally the same as in the case of purely plane surface that is not correct. In the present work we give correct formulas for acoustic ray interaction with arbitrary smooth non-plane reflecting surfaces and demonstrate the application of these theoretical results by some test examples.
